Types of Textile Tester


Textile testers come in various forms, each designed for specific evaluations:

  • Fabric Strength Testers: Measure tensile, tear, and burst strength.
  • Colorfastness Testers: Assess resistance to washing, light, and rubbing.
  • Pilling Testers: Evaluate fabric surface wear and pilling formation.
  • Air Permeability Testers: Determine breathability of fabrics.
  • Flammability Testers: Check fire resistance properties.

Textile Tester Q & A


Q: How often should a textile tester be calibrated?
A: Calibration frequency depends on usage, but generally every 6-12 months or per manufacturer guidelines.


Q: Can one tester handle multiple fabric types?
A: Many modern testers accommodate various materials, but check specifications for compatibility.


Q: What's the typical lead time when ordering from China?
A: Standard models ship in 2-4 weeks; custom configurations may take 6-8 weeks.
